#295495 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#295495 is composed of 16.1% red, 32.9%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.5% cyan, 43.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 216.1 degrees, a saturation of 56.8% and a lightness of 37.3%. #295495 color hex could be obtained by blending #52a8ff with #00002b.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#295495 color description : Dark blue.
#295495 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#295495 has RGB values of R:41, G:84,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0.44,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 2708629.

Shades and Tints of #295495
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03060b is the darkest color, while #fafc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#295495
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c5e62 is the less saturated color, while #044dba is the most saturated one.
